Abstract
The primary economic concern of the market players in the restructured electricity market is the practice of market power by one or more participants. Market power practice can encumber competition in power production, service quality and technological innovation. This paper proposes a new composite method for investigating market power under congested condition. This method is based on an improved technique of locational marginal price (LMP) design employing shift-factor optimal power flow. Market concentration and social cost of congested are evaluated. Numerical example on the 24-bus IEEE Reliability Test system (IEEE-RTS) is presented to illustrate the proposed method.
